Western side of Cove Creek arm off of the Dale Hollow Reservoir (Carboniferous of the United States)

Also known as CC; Dale Hollow West

Where: Tennessee (36.6° N, 85.2° W: paleocoordinates 23.4° S, 33.5° W)

• coordinate estimated from map

When: Gnathodus texanus conodont zone, Fort Payne Formation, Osagean (352.0 - 343.0 Ma)

Environment/lithology: reef, buildup or bioherm; shelly/skeletal packstone

• Not given, but clusters with sheetlike packstones.

Size class: macrofossils

Reposited in the OSU, USNM

Primary reference: E. B. Krivicich, W. I. Ausich, and D. L. Meyer. 2014. Crinoid assemblages from the Fort Payne Formation (late Osagean, early Viséan, Mississippian) from Kentucky, Tennessee, and Alabama. Journal of Paleontology 88(6):1154-1162 [P. Wagner/P. Wagner]more details

Purpose of describing collection: taxonomic analysis
